So sad. May their souls rest in peace. I warned earlier. Lagos state tried but still failed to demolish as many houses as possible. StOla: Mende wey I know like the back of my hand.
Many built houses that later sank into the ground.
Pako bridge linking Mende at Ajose street to Ojota, used to have a house that only the top window of the 1st floor was still above the ground. It eventually got demolished and the mechanics around there expanded their workshop over it.
All the canal pathway within Mende has been turned into one estate or the other. In those days, you will stand on the ground near the swamp area of Mende, and the ground will be bouncing.
Same thing applied to Arowojobe Estate in Mende, but people kept on sandfilling the swamps and building houses like no man's business.
Gone are the days Alligators used to be found in the canal areas of Mende |
